Paper Plane Earth
The aim of the game is to time your jump accurately to avoid the obstacles which are the famous monuments and landmarks of the world. The earth keeps rotating with the monuments on top and the paper plane has to jump over those to score points. When the paper plan crashes onto the monuments, it is game over!
Game Instructions: Paper Plane Earth Edition
The game has pretty simple controlling:
1. Tap to start
2. Tap to jump and avoid the monuments!
